2010-02-08 7 views
1

Edit: Trouvé que cela se produit même si Cufon n'est même pas appliqué! Edit2: Mon mauvais, on dirait que Cufon est en train de créer le afterall sans effort. Toutefois, la suppression de la ligne où je remplace le style de police de menuwrapper avec Cufon entraîne toujours un comportement léthargique. Donc, il ne semble pas que cela ait quelque chose à voir avec l'application de Cufon aux listes elles-mêmes.Comportement léthargique avec li: hover avec Cufon


Bonjour, J'utilise Cufon pour "intégrer" une police personnalisée à mon site. Et cette police est utilisée dans le menu principal et j'ai rencontré un bogue ou quelque chose dont le réglage de la hauteur, du remplissage ou de tout ce qui est lié au li: hover rend IE lent. Je ne sais pas pourquoi cela se produit mais le problème disparaît lorsque je supprime la propriété du li: hover. Cela fonctionne bien dans Firefox cependant. Donc, ma question est la suivante: y a-t-il une autre façon de contourner ce problème?

Ce que j'essaie de faire, c'est de positionner li: hover parce qu'il y a un arrière-plan. Et je veux l'incliner de quelques pixels vers le bas.

Mon CSS ressemble à ceci:

 
    #menuwrapper { 
float:right; 
margin-top:10px; 
height: 65px; 
} 

.menuwrapper li { 
float:right; 
list-style: none; 
margin-top:10px; 
padding-top:18px; 
padding-left: 23px; 
padding-right: 23px; 
height:23px; 
} 

.menuwrapper a{ 
font-family:georgia; 
font-size:22px; 
color:#ebebeb; 
text-decoration:none; 
} 

.menuwrapper li:hover { 
background-image: url(img/MenuHover.png); 
padding-bottom:6px; 
} 

Répondre

0

Impossible de comprendre ce que vous voulez dire exactement, mais comme vous avez dit que vous voulez obtenir un peu plus bas en bas, vous pouvez le faire avec margin-top Propriété css.

margin-top:10px; /* down it by 10 pixels */ 
+0

Oui, mais cela entraîne un comportement léthargique de li: hover. En fait, la définition de TOUTE propriété de remplissage, de marge, de hauteur ou de largeur semble provoquer un ralentissement. Même si je n'ai même pas appliqué Cufon à la liste elle-même. Tant que Cufon est sur la page, tout objet li: hover a un comportement paresseux nomatter quoi. Très étrange. –

0

Je devrais juste jeter celui-ci je suppose. Ne trouvant nulle part avec elle comme c'est maintenant.